Went for a run this morning.  Cold and foggy.  The damp gets the chill right into your bones somehow, and into your lungs.  The cars were iced up and the pavement slippery in patches.  Stringy spider webs sagging in the hedges. 

Still, now I feel all warm and virtuous and deserving of porridge.

10km is about 6.25 miles, which sounds horrendous, but isn't if you take it in bits. If you can run 2.5 miles, you can run 3 miles. When you're running 3 miles, you can run 4 miles. When you're running 4 miles, you can go straight to 6 if you're feeling good. I am not exactly fast myself. I'm 52 and overweight. If I'm going REALLY WELL, my aim is to complete the Great Womens Run 10km in under an hour...
